Who funds Friends of Lexington Preservation

EIN 85-1374226 · Lexington, MS · NTEE S99

Friends of Lexington Preservation of Lexington, MS (EIN 85-1374226) was named as a grant recipient by 4 funders in 4 grants paid totaling $56,107 in tax years 2020–2025,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
